JUDGMENT OF THE COURT OF FIRST INSTANCE
of 31 May 2005
in Case T- 294/03,Jean-Louis Gibault v Commission of the European Communities 1 (Open competition - Non-inclusion on the list of successful candidates - Lack of a statement of reasons - Discrimination on grounds of nationality)
(Language of the case: French)
In Case T-294/03: Jean-Louis Gibault, residing in Wattrelos (France), represented by F.Tuytschaever, lawyer, against Commission of the European Communities (Agent: J. Currall, with an address for service in Luxembourg) ( application for annulment of the decision of the selection board for open competition COM/A/6/01 not to include the applicant on the list of successful candidates ( the Court of First Instance (First Chamber), composed of J.D. Cooke, President, I. Labucka and V. Trstenjak, Judges; I. Natsinas, Administrator, for the Registrar, gave a judgment on 31 May 2005, in which it:
1. Dismisses the application as unfounded;
2. Orders the parties to bear their own costs.
